Customizable graphics options for Xbox

It would be great if we could see some level of advanced graphic customization options for Xbox to allow more advanced simmers the options to tune performance vs visual settings to their individual liking. In particular things such as the “glass cockpit refresh rate” for those of us who primarily fly military based aircraft.

I understand there is probably a desire to minimize support issues and ensure consistent game play quality on the Xbox platform by limiting configuration options. But there are other games on Xbox that allow for graphics customizations far beyond just the simple HDR10 on/off option we get in MSFS.

And while you could argue that “advanced simmers” should invest in the PC platform, there are some of us who are investing in other areas first (ie HOTAS, simming chair, sound systems, etc. etc.) as a first step while leveraging our existing investment in an Xbox system that provides great value to get into flying ($499) before spending the $3k-$4k on a proper PC / VR rig. I cannot see a quality vs. performance option being instated that is incapable of ensuring CTDs do not happen in either setting state.

There are too many end users with varying levels of experience and expectations to allow a setting within the sim to be set “wrong” and start causing the sim to CTD.

The crux of the problem is the CTDs and the solution is to find and eliminate the causes of those CTDs, not add a band-aid “solution” that still allows the sim to CTD if set wrong.

The only time a quality vs. performance option should exist is when it safe to run the sim in either setting regardless of installed Marketplace content.
